From inside the stunning opal necklace, a haunting voice whispered, "Make love to him, Faith. Do it now!" Faith Abbot is a good Puritan woman, but the magic inside an opal necklace begins to torment her with lustful thoughts. For years her heart and body have craved handsome James Parris, a man twelve years her junior, a man she thinks should be courting women his own age. But now the magic of a ghost trapped in a jewel breaks down all her inhibitions. When she and James surrender to the fierce erotic tension that pulses between them, her heart fills with joy. But who is the angry female ghost dwelling within the necklace, wanting revenge?
